Here's how it normally works: Package cools a tank of water, and then sends the cooled water through the tubes, which are woven through the mattress pad. Everything looks a bit laboratorial, up until you throw a fitted sheet on top. Then it looks typical, except for a rubber tube extending from your bed into a gently-whirring white box.

It's advised for the Cube to be put on a flat surface, with each of its sides having at least 2 feet of breathing space. Given that it should be plugged in, it's necessary to have an outlet close by (chilipad vs dual temp). To avoid any leak, the water tank needs to be positioned on top.
It's finest to utilize distilled water to avoid any sediment from forming in the tank and within televisions. The Cube functions as a central system that pumps the water through silicone microtubes that are spread throughout the pad. Once you turn the Cube on, the water will begin to distribute through televisions; as this occurs, you will need to add water till the Cube is full again.
As the icons suggest, one decreases the temperature, while the other raises it. For the best results of temperature level change, it's advised to turn the system on a minimum of half an hour prior to going to sleep. The remotes are cordless and use radio frequency, so you do not need to point it straight at the system for it to sign up the commands.
The system uses less than 80 watts to operate, and it turns itself off after 10 hours (chilipad vs bedjet). You can also set the timer if you do not want it running for the entire night. This makes it more energy-efficient than using a/c to warm up or cool down the whole space - chilipad cube 2.0.

You can alter the temperature of the pad in increments of one-degree, and the settings range from 55-110F (13-43C). This temperature level range means that if you're either a hot or cold sleeper, you'll discover your comfort zone. chilipad review noise. When it's turned on, the system does produce a faint hum, due to the fans inside it.
If you're an extremely light sleeper, this might affect your experience, however the noise isn't loud, and after a long time, you can hardly see it. Single Zone ChiliPads will have 1 cube and one temperature control for the whole pad. Dual Zone pads offer 2 zones of temperature level control. This is meant for couples to be able to set different temperature levels on their side of the matters.
